Bazaar vs. Bizarre: Understanding the Differences and Applications

In the realms of language and commerce, the words "bazaar" and "bizarre" often cause confusion, not just for ESL learners but even for native speakers. Although they sound similar, they convey entirely different meanings, usages, and contexts. This article will explore these differences in detail, helping you to communicate more effectively and understand the nuances of each term.

What is a Bazaar?

A bazaar refers to a marketplace commonly found in Middle Eastern and South Asian regions. Bazaars are places where merchants sell a variety of goods, from spices and textiles to crafts and electronics. These vibrant markets are not only significant for trade but also for cultural exchange and social interaction.

History and Cultural Significance

Historically, bazaars have been vital to trade routes, connecting traders and travelers from different cultures. They served as hubs for commerce, where people would gather to buy and sell products. The iconic Grand Bazaar in Istanbul, one of the largest and oldest covered markets in the world, is a prime example. You can explore more about its rich history here.

Modern-Day Bazaars

Today, bazaars often cater to tourists but remain essential for local commerce. Many cities around the world have adopted the bazaar model, featuring everything from food stalls to artisanal crafts. Online platforms have also emerged, mimicking the bazaar experience by allowing vendors to sell unique goods directly to consumers.

What is Bizarre?

In contrast to the bustling marketplace, bizarre is an adjective used to describe something that is very strange, unusual, or out of the ordinary. It can refer to situations, behaviors, or objects that evoke surprise, confusion, or amusement.

Origin of the Word

The word "bizarre" comes from the French word of the same spelling, meaning "strange," and it can also be traced back to the Basque word "bizar," meaning "beard." This etymology reflects the unusual nature of the term itself.

Usage in Everyday Language

The term "bizarre" is frequently used in pop culture to describe anything from quirky fashion choices to odd behaviors or peculiar stories. For example, someone might refer to a particularly strange movie plot as "bizarre." For more on bizarre events and phenomena, check out The Strange and Bizarre.

How to Remember the Difference

One simple way to differentiate these two terms is to remember their contexts:

  • Bazaar: Think of a marketplace filled with colorful goods and busy vendors. The ‘z’ in bazaar can remind you of ‘zone’ or ‘zone of commerce.’

  • Bizarre: Connect this word to the idea of strangeness or peculiarity. The double ‘z’ can stand for ‘crazy’ or ‘zany’ traits.

Examples in Sentences

To further illustrate the differences, here are some sentences using each word:

  1. Bazaar: "The local bazaar is filled with vibrant colors and exotic scents."

  2. Bizarre: "I had a bizarre dream last night where I was flying on a giant potato."
